Top 5 NFT Games Performance in Angola for Q4 2021
Explore the performance trends of the top 5 NFT games in Angola for the fourth quarter of 2021, including downloads, revenue, and active user metrics.
The fourth quarter of 2021 saw varying performance trends among the top 5 NFT games in Angola on a unified platform. Here's a closer look at how each app performed in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
IMVU: Social Chat & Avatar app experienced noteworthy trends throughout Q4 2021. Weekly revenue showed a gradual increase, peaking at approximately $85 in the week of December 20. Downloads fluctuated, with a peak of around 507 in the final week of December. Active users also saw an upward trend, rising from 1.2K at the start of the quarter to 1.8K by the end of December.
Thetan Arena: MOBA Survival showed moderate growth in weekly downloads, starting at 14 in late November and reaching 144 by the end of December. Revenue saw a brief spike, with the highest point at $16 in early December. Active users increased steadily, rising from 67 in late November to 150 by the end of the quarter.
Arc8 Beasts: Win Cash Prizes had minimal activity in terms of downloads and active users. Downloads peaked at 31 in late September but dropped to single digits by the end of the quarter. Active users followed a similar trend, starting at 40 and dwindling down to 10 by early December.
Granny's House had a sporadic performance in weekly downloads, with peaks of 14 in early December and 21 in mid-December. However, the app did not generate any revenue or active user data throughout the quarter.
Lastly, ScratchJr showed low but consistent weekly downloads, peaking at 14 in late September and maintaining single digits for most of the quarter. No revenue or active user data was recorded for this app.
